近日,有知情人士透露,全球知名人工智能研究机构OpenAI正积极与美国三大主流媒体巨头——美国有线电视新闻网(CNN)、福克斯公司及时代周刊展开深度合作谈判。OpenAI此次寻求与上述媒体达成内容使用协议,意在获取涵盖视频、图片、文本及各类内容在内的使用权。此举旨在丰富其自身平台上的信息资源,为用户提供更为广泛和多元的知识服务。

据了解,OpenAI近期在版权领域的法律纠纷日益增多,特别是在处理媒体内容引用与授权方面的问题上面临挑战。面对此类困境,与传统媒体建立合作关系并获得正式的内容许可成为OpenAI当前的重要战略考量。通过与CNN、福克斯公司和时代周刊等权威媒体的合作,OpenAI有望规避潜在的版权风险,同时进一步提升自身的公信力和信息服务水平。

财联社消息称,这项内容许可协议的谈判尚处于初期阶段,但显示出OpenAI对于媒体资源的高度重视及其在适应行业发展需求、解决版权争议方面的积极应对姿态。业界观察家指出,这一跨行业合作或将成为未来AI技术与传统媒体融合的新模式,对推动数字内容产业的健康发展具有重要意义。

Content: Recently, insiders have disclosed that the globally renowned artificial intelligence research institution, OpenAI, is actively embroiled in deep cooperation talks with three major American mainstream media giants – Cable News Network (CNN), Fox Corporation, and Time magazine. OpenAI is currently seeking to establish content usage agreements with these media houses, aiming to gain rights to utilize multimedia content including videos, images, text, and various other materials. This move is intended to enrich its platform’s information resources, providing users with more extensive and diverse knowledge services.

It has been revealed that OpenAI’s legal disputes in the copyright realm have been on the rise lately, particularly regarding issues surrounding the handling of media content references and authorization. In light of such challenges, establishing partnerships with traditional media and obtaining formal content licenses has become a crucial strategic consideration for OpenAI. By collaborating with authoritative media like CNN, Fox, and Time, OpenAI aims to mitigate potential copyright risks while simultaneously enhancing its credibility and service quality as an information provider.

According to Caixin Global, the negotiation for this content licensing agreement is still in its early stages but demonstrates OpenAI’s high regard for media resources and its proactive stance in adapting to industry development needs and addressing copyright disputes. Industry observers suggest that this cross-sector collaboration could pave the way for a new model of integration between AI technology and traditional media, holding significant implications for the healthy development of the digital content industry in the future.
